Balanced and Barefoot by Angela Hanscom

A printed copy of how I’m generally trying to raise my children. Nature is the best place for them to be and I will always encourage them to be outside.

I don’t entirely agree with or had some scenarios in mind that the author presented. My disagreeing thoughts in no apparent order…
1. babies being in grass will run their hands through it. No, they’ll definitely pull it and put it in their mouths. I think they need to be watched more closely outside.
2. Babies are still stimulated from natural environments even when they’re being worn. While it’s lovely to say or imagine that carrying your little one everywhere outdoors is ideal, it’s just not logistical for most scenarios.
3. Teenagers only  eed 3-4 hours of active play. Obviously depending on personality and energy level, I believe they need more.


Aside from those things, I love this logic and it puts into words what my husband and I are striving for with our babies.
